Decoding the Physical Indicators of a Long Life
Beyond the visible signs of aging like wrinkles or gray hair, scientists have identified a number of physical markers that are strong predictors of overall health and lifespan. These indicators provide a more accurate picture of your biological age—the true state of your cellular and organ health—compared to your chronological age. Focusing on improving these markers can significantly increase your healthspan, the period of life spent free from chronic disease. The Central Role of Muscular Strength and Mass
One of the most compelling physical markers of longevity is muscular strength. Declining muscle mass, a condition known as sarcopenia, is a natural part of aging but can be mitigated through consistent effort.
Grip Strength
More than just a measure of a firm handshake, grip strength is a powerful biomarker for overall muscular health and a predictor of all-cause mortality. Studies have shown that lower grip strength is associated with an increased risk of premature death from various causes, including heart disease. It is a simple yet effective tool for assessing functional capacity.
Leg Strength
Strong leg muscles are critical for maintaining mobility, balance, and independence as we age. Low leg strength is linked to a higher risk of falls, disability, and premature death. Performance on functional tests, such as the sit-to-stand test, can provide insight into lower body power, which is vital for daily activities and overall health.
Cardiovascular Fitness: The Engine of Longevity
Your heart and lung function play a fundamental role in your longevity. Cardiovascular health is often measured by VO2 max, which represents the maximum amount of oxygen your body can utilize during intense exercise.
- Higher VO2 Max, Lower Mortality: A higher VO2 max is strongly associated with a lower risk of early death from all causes. Regular aerobic exercise, such as brisk walking, swimming, or cycling, can significantly improve and maintain your VO2 max.
- Aerobic Exercise Benefits: Aim for at least 150 minutes of moderate-intensity aerobic exercise per week. Consistency is key to slowing the age-related decline in cardiovascular fitness.
Metabolic and Cellular Health Indicators
Longevity is also rooted in metabolic and cellular processes. Blood tests and advanced diagnostics can reveal crucial internal markers of your aging trajectory.
- HbA1c and Blood Glucose: HbA1c measures your average blood sugar levels over the past 2–3 months. Keeping glucose levels in check is critical, as elevated blood sugar is a major risk factor for type 2 diabetes and cardiovascular disease, both of which shorten healthspan.
- Inflammatory Markers: Chronic, low-grade inflammation (often called "inflammaging") is a key driver of age-related disease. High-sensitivity C-Reactive Protein (hs-CRP) is a blood marker that indicates systemic inflammation. Keeping hs-CRP levels low is associated with a longer, healthier life.
- Telomere Length: Telomeres are protective caps at the ends of your chromosomes that shorten with each cell division. Shorter telomeres are associated with increased risk of chronic illness and premature death. While telomere length is partly genetic, lifestyle factors like exercise and diet can influence the rate of shortening.
- Mitochondrial Function: Mitochondria are the powerhouses of your cells, and their dysfunction is a hallmark of aging. With age, mitochondria become less efficient, leading to increased oxidative stress and reduced energy production. Lifestyle interventions like caloric restriction and exercise have been shown to improve mitochondrial function.
The Importance of Balance and Mobility
Good balance is not just about avoiding falls; it is a critical measure of neuromuscular function and proprioception that is essential for independence in later life.
- Balance Tests: Simple tests, such as the single-leg stance, can provide a quick assessment of your balance.
- Fall Prevention: Falls are a leading cause of injury and disability in older adults. Improving balance through exercises like yoga or tai chi can significantly reduce this risk.

Actionable Strategies for Improving Longevity Markers
Optimizing your physical markers for longevity involves a holistic approach to lifestyle. The following strategies are backed by research and can help you live a longer, healthier life:
- Prioritize Regular Exercise: A mix of aerobic activity (150+ minutes/week) and strength training (2-4 times/week) is ideal. Exercise improves VO2 max, preserves muscle mass, and reduces inflammation. Even small increases in daily activity can have a positive impact.
- Maintain a Healthy Weight: Obesity is associated with accelerated aging and increased disease risk. Maintaining a healthy body weight through diet and exercise can improve metabolic markers like HbA1c and lower inflammation.

- Get Quality Sleep: Adequate, restful sleep is essential for cellular repair and regeneration. Poor sleep is linked to higher inflammation and an increased risk of chronic disease. Aim for 7–8 hours per night consistently.
- Manage Stress: Chronic stress accelerates aging at a cellular level. Practices like mindfulness, meditation, and spending time in nature can help reduce stress and lower inflammatory markers.
- Stay Socially Connected: Strong social connections are linked to better emotional health and a longer lifespan. Social engagement provides a sense of purpose and helps buffer against stress.
